Flowchart No.3
Symptom
Possible cause
• Damaged power seat switch
• Damaged front-lift motor
• Open or short circuit in wiring harness
• Poor connection of connector
Flowchart No.4
Symptom
Possible cause
• Damaged power seat switch
• Damaged rear-lift motor
• Open or short circuit in wiring harness
• Poor connection of connector

POWER SEAT
Front of driver's seat does not move up or down
Remedy
1. Measure the voltage at the terminal wires of the front-lift
motor with the power seat switch in the following posi­
tions.
Switch position
Front lift
If correct, c ieck the front- ift motor.
2.
(Refer to page P1-10.)
3. If not as specified, repair the wiring harness
(power seat switch—front-lift motor).
Rear of driver's seat does not move up or down
Remedy
. Measure the voltage at the terminal wires of the rear-lift
1
motor connector with the power seat switch in the fol­
lowing positions.
Switch position
Rear lift
2. If correct, check the rear-lift motor.
(Refer to page P1-10.)
3. If not as specified, repair the wiring harness
(power seat switch—rear-lift motor).
